Subject: [PATCH 07/15] sched_ext: Wrap deferred_reenq_local_node into a struct
Date: Fri,  6 Mar 2026 09:06:15 -1000	[thread overview]
Message-ID: <20260306190623.1076074-8-tj@kernel.org> (raw)
In-Reply-To: <20260306190623.1076074-1-tj@kernel.org>

Wrap the deferred_reenq_local_node list_head into struct
scx_deferred_reenq_local. More fields will be added and this allows using a
shorthand pointer to access them.

No functional change.

diff --git a/kernel/sched/ext.c b/kernel/sched/ext.c
index ffccaf04e34d..80d1e6ccc326 100644
--- a/kernel/sched/ext.c
+++ b/kernel/sched/ext.c
@@ -3648,15 +3648,19 @@ static void process_deferred_reenq_locals(struct rq *rq)
 		struct scx_sched *sch;
 
 		scoped_guard (raw_spinlock, &rq->scx.deferred_reenq_lock) {
-			struct scx_sched_pcpu *sch_pcpu =
+			struct scx_deferred_reenq_local *drl =
 				list_first_entry_or_null(&rq->scx.deferred_reenq_locals,
-							 struct scx_sched_pcpu,
-							 deferred_reenq_local_node);
-			if (!sch_pcpu)
+							 struct scx_deferred_reenq_local,
+							 node);
+			struct scx_sched_pcpu *sch_pcpu;
+
+			if (!drl)
 				return;
 
+			sch_pcpu = container_of(drl, struct scx_sched_pcpu,
+						deferred_reenq_local);
 			sch = sch_pcpu->sch;
-			list_del_init(&sch_pcpu->deferred_reenq_local_node);
+			list_del_init(&drl->node);
 		}
 
 		reenq_local(sch, rq);
@@ -4200,7 +4204,7 @@ static void scx_sched_free_rcu_work(struct work_struct *work)
 	for_each_possible_cpu(cpu) {
 		struct scx_sched_pcpu *pcpu = per_cpu_ptr(sch->pcpu, cpu);
 
-		WARN_ON_ONCE(!list_empty(&pcpu->deferred_reenq_local_node));
+		WARN_ON_ONCE(!list_empty(&pcpu->deferred_reenq_local.node));
 	}
 
 	free_percpu(sch->pcpu);
@@ -5813,7 +5817,7 @@ static struct scx_sched *scx_alloc_and_add_sched(struct sched_ext_ops *ops,
 		struct scx_sched_pcpu *pcpu = per_cpu_ptr(sch->pcpu, cpu);
 
 		pcpu->sch = sch;
-		INIT_LIST_HEAD(&pcpu->deferred_reenq_local_node);
+		INIT_LIST_HEAD(&pcpu->deferred_reenq_local.node);
 	}
 
 	sch->helper = kthread_run_worker(0, "sched_ext_helper");
@@ -8391,8 +8395,8 @@ __bpf_kfunc void scx_bpf_reenqueue_local___v2(const struct bpf_prog_aux *aux)
 	scoped_guard (raw_spinlock, &rq->scx.deferred_reenq_lock) {
 		struct scx_sched_pcpu *pcpu = this_cpu_ptr(sch->pcpu);
 
-		if (list_empty(&pcpu->deferred_reenq_local_node))
-			list_move_tail(&pcpu->deferred_reenq_local_node,
+		if (list_empty(&pcpu->deferred_reenq_local.node))
+			list_move_tail(&pcpu->deferred_reenq_local.node,
 				       &rq->scx.deferred_reenq_locals);
 	}
 
diff --git a/kernel/sched/ext_internal.h b/kernel/sched/ext_internal.h
index 80d40a9c5ad9..1a8d61097cab 100644
--- a/kernel/sched/ext_internal.h
+++ b/kernel/sched/ext_internal.h
@@ -954,6 +954,10 @@ struct scx_dsp_ctx {
 	struct scx_dsp_buf_ent	buf[];
 };
 
+struct scx_deferred_reenq_local {
+	struct list_head	node;
+};
+
 struct scx_sched_pcpu {
 	struct scx_sched	*sch;
 	u64			flags;	/* protected by rq lock */
@@ -965,7 +969,7 @@ struct scx_sched_pcpu {
 	 */
 	struct scx_event_stats	event_stats;
 
-	struct list_head	deferred_reenq_local_node;
+	struct scx_deferred_reenq_local deferred_reenq_local;
 	struct scx_dispatch_q	bypass_dsq;
 #ifdef CONFIG_EXT_SUB_SCHED
 	u32			bypass_host_seq;
